#556cc0 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#556cc0 is composed of 33.3% red, 42.4% green and 75.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 55.7% cyan, 43.8% magenta, 0% yellow and 24.7% black. It has a hue angle of 227.1 degrees, a saturation of 45.9% and a lightness of 54.3%. #556cc0 color hex could be obtained by blending #aad8ff with #000081. Closest websafe color is: #6666cc.

#556cc0 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#556cc0 has RGB values of R:85, G:108, B:192 and CMYK values of C:0.56, M:0.44, Y:0, K:0.25. Its decimal value is 5598400.

Hex triplet 556cc0 #556cc0
RGB Decimal 85, 108, 192 rgb(85,108,192)
RGB Percent 33.3, 42.4, 75.3 rgb(33.3%,42.4%,75.3%)
CMYK 56, 44, 0, 25
HSL 227.1°, 45.9, 54.3 hsl(227.1,45.9%,54.3%)
HSV (or HSB) 227.1°, 55.7, 75.3
Web Safe 6666cc #6666cc
CIE-LAB 47.574, 16.372, -46.783
XYZ 18.621, 16.461, 52.062
xyY 0.214, 0.189, 16.461
CIE-LCH 47.574, 49.565, 289.288
CIE-LUV 47.574, -13.124, -72.384
Hunter-Lab 40.573, 10.923, -47.68
Binary 01010101, 01101100, 11000000

Shades and Tints of #556cc0

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010102 is the darkest color, while #f2f4fa is the lightest one.

Tones of #556cc0

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#828693 is the less saturated color, while #1648ff is the most saturated one.
